Gearing up your Driver and Working Hours Legislation
The Northern Logistics Academy is a logistics and transport training specialist, based in the Northwest of England, delivering sector specific training and qualifications. We are JAUPT approved for the delivery of Driver CPC periodic training courses.
If you drive a lorry, bus or coach as the main part of your job, it is a legal requirement that you must hold the full Driver Certificate of Professional Competence (CPC).
To gain this you must do either 35 hours of periodic training every 5 years or, 7 hours training per year in order to maintain your Driver Certificate of Professional Competence.

Course programme
This course will guarantee that as an employee, you have a solid understanding of the EU driver's hours, the European Agreement Concerning the Work of Crews of Vehicles Engaged in International Road Transport (AETR), Working Time Directive (WTD) and GB domestic rules.
The workshop will cover the following modules:
- Overview of Legislation: outlining the importance of driver hours and the WTD, the impact it has on their work life and the importance of staying legal.
- Understanding the EU Rules: updated legislation covering EU rules, to provide a solid understanding of the requirements for driving, breaks and rests period.
- The Driver and The Working Time Directive: familiarisation with Working Time Directive (Road Transport Directive) and a refresher of the basic rules that apply regarding the driver dovetailing the WTD with the EU hours and recognising infringements.
- Applying the EU Rules: delivering a practical understanding of the rules covering EU driver hours.
- Understanding the GB Domestic Rules: providing an in-depth insight into GB domestic rules, in order that you comprehend duty time, daily driving time and what breaks and rest periods are required.
- What you need to know about Tachograph rules: understand the methods of recording and maintaining driver records for both GB domestic rules and EU regulations including infringements and enforcements.
- Responsibilities and Penalties: an overview of the responsibilities of the driver and the operator and to understand how the legislation is enforced and the penalties associated with infringements.
